Jogging around Hanerau-Hademarschen offers a variety of routes through the region's characteristic flat to gently rolling terrain. The landscape is primarily defined by open fields, agricultural areas, and occasional wooded sections, providing a peaceful setting for running. With low elevation gains across most routes, the area is well-suited for accessible and enjoyable running experiences. There are nearly 80 running routes available, catering to different preferences and fitness levels.

There are nearly 80 running routes around Hanerau-Hademarschen, offering a wide variety of options for different fitness levels and preferences. The region's flat to gently rolling terrain makes it accessible for many runners.
Yes, Hanerau-Hademarschen offers several easy running routes perfect for beginners or those looking for a relaxed run. An excellent option is the Running loop from Hanerau-Hademarschen, an easy 3.1-mile (4.9 km) path that provides a straightforward run through the local surroundings.
The jogging trails in Hanerau-Hademarschen are primarily characterized by open fields, agricultural areas, and occasional wooded sections. The terrain is generally flat to gently rolling, with low elevation gains, making for a peaceful and accessible running experience.
Yes, many of the running paths in the area are circular,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. For instance, the popular Gehege Rehers loop from Hademarschen is a 5.4-mile (8.7 km) route that takes you through varied wooded areas.
The running routes in Hanerau-Hademarschen are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ars from over 30 reviews. Runners often praise the peaceful setting, varied landscapes, and the well-maintained paths that make for an enjoyable experience.
While many routes are easy to moderate, there are options for longer runs. For example, the Running loop from Warringholz is a moderate 5.5-mile (8.9 km) route that offers a good distance for those looking to extend their run.
Yes, the region offers several points of interest. You might encounter highlights such as the Mühlenteich Albersdorf or the Gieselau Canal Lock and Bascule Bridge. The routes often pass through charming rural landscapes and quiet country lanes.
Many of the easier and shorter routes, such as the Running loop from Lütjenwestedt (2.2 miles / 3.5 km), are well-suited for families looking to enjoy a run together. The generally flat terrain and peaceful environment make them accessible for all ages.
Spring and autumn are particularly pleasant for jogging in Hanerau-Hademarschen, with mild temperatures and beautiful scenery as the fields change color. Summer mornings and evenings also offer great conditions, while winter can be enjoyed on clear, crisp days, though some paths might be muddy.
Absolutely. Many routes originate from various villages around Hanerau-Hademarschen, providing convenient starting points. For instance, you can find routes like the Running loop from Steenfeld, which offers a moderate 3.3-mile (5.3 km) run through the rural landscape.
Generally, the open fields and wooded sections around Hanerau-Hademarschen are welcoming for runners with dogs. It's always recommended to keep dogs on a leash, especially near agricultural areas or wildlife, and to respect local regulations regarding pets.
The running trails in Hanerau-Hademarschen vary in length, with options ranging from shorter paths of around 2-3 miles (3-5 km) to longer routes exceeding 5 miles (8 km). This variety ensures there's a suitable distance for every runner.
